Why Idle Speed Adjusting Screw Is Necessary
I find the idle speed adjusting screw necessary because it helps me keep the engine running smoothly when the vehicle is not accelerating. Without it, my engine could idle too low and stall, or idle too high and waste fuel. It gives me a simple way to fine-tune the engine’s resting speed so it stays stable and reliable.
My experience is that this screw is especially useful when I want the engine to run properly under different conditions, like cold starts, engine wear, or small changes in load. It allows me to make quick adjustments without needing major repairs. That means better control, easier starting, and a more consistent idle.
I also see it as an important part of maintaining comfort and efficiency. When the idle speed is set correctly, my engine sounds smoother, my vehicle responds better, and unnecessary strain on parts is reduced. In short, it helps me keep the engine balanced and dependable.

What I Look for in an Idle Speed Adjusting Screw
When I shop for an idle speed adjusting screw, I first check whether it matches my vehicle or equipment model exactly. I’ve learned that even a small mismatch in thread size, length, or head type can cause poor fitment or tuning issues. I also look for good material quality, since a screw that resists wear and corrosion lasts much longer.
Why Compatibility Matters to Me
Compatibility is the first thing I verify before buying. I always compare the part number, dimensions, and application details with my carburetor or throttle body. If I’m not sure, I use the manufacturer’s manual or cross-reference charts to avoid wasting money on the wrong part.
Material and Build Quality I Prefer
I usually choose screws made from durable metal with corrosion resistance, especially if the part will be exposed to fuel, moisture, or heat. A well-made screw should turn smoothly without stripping. In my experience, cheap parts often wear out quickly and make fine adjustments harder.
Ease of Adjustment
I like an idle speed adjusting screw that allows precise and smooth tuning. If the screw is too stiff or too loose, it becomes frustrating to set the idle correctly. I prefer a design that lets me make small adjustments without slipping or damaging the head.
Fit and Thread Accuracy
Thread accuracy is very important to me. A screw with poor threading can cross-thread easily or fail to hold its setting. I always inspect product details and reviews to see whether other buyers mention fit issues before I decide.
Brand Reputation and Reviews
I pay attention to brand reputation because it gives me confidence in the part’s reliability. I also read customer reviews to see if others had the same machine, engine, or carburetor setup as mine. Real user feedback helps me avoid parts that look good on paper but don’t perform well in practice.
Price vs. Value
I don’t always buy the cheapest option. Instead, I look for the best value. For me, a slightly more expensive idle speed adjusting screw is worth it if it fits properly, lasts longer, and makes tuning easier. I’d rather pay once for a quality part than replace a low-cost one repeatedly.
Installation Tips I Follow
Before installing, I make sure the engine is off and cool. I clean the area around the screw so dirt doesn’t get inside the carburetor or throttle assembly. I also adjust it slowly, since small turns can make a big difference in idle speed.
